Buying a Laser Level that is not Specific to Your Situation

This is one of the costliest mistakes you can make and many laser level users have made it in the past. For instance, you should avoid buying a commercial grade rotary laser level when all you do is use a rotary laser level occasionally in your home. Some rotary laser levels are quite complex and may just be too heavy or cumbersome for your home use. Do not get carried away by too many features and accessories and the capability of a rotary laser level, you may only need a low to medium end laser level that suits your needs. A rotary laser level has 100 feet range and provides up to 1/16” accuracy should be ideal for your indoor or home DIY jobs. 

Always Putting Green Laser Above Red Laser

It is true that green laser levels are brighter and travel farther than red lasers but that does not mean a green laser beam will be the best option for you. Green lasers tend to be brighter and reach longer distances than red because the human eye picks up the green color much easier and green lasers operate a different wavelength. You should consider the downsides of a green laser which perhaps can help you make a better choice and save money. The green laser for instance consumes more power than red lasers due to their higher intensities and that makes them use up more battery power. The more battery power your laser level consumes, the more recharging or change of battery you will need.  If you consider how much you will spend on battery replacements alone, you will consider opting for a red laser instead of a green laser.

Buying on Auction Sites

Buying rotary laser levels on auction sites could be your greatest mistake as regards buying cheap laser levels. May laser levels put up for sale or auction on these sites have been used before and some of them do have hidden faults that might not have been revealed by their original owners. You will have to exercise a lot of caution when purchasing such laser levels and ask for details from the owners to ensure that you are not buying a bad product. Sometimes people sell or auction stolen items on auction sites and this could put you in serious crisis when such products are tracked down. It is better to stay away from auction sites completely. 

Buying a Product with no Warranty

It can be quite easy to fall into the warranty trap especially when you disregard such information. The warranty information is written on the manual of the product and you should look up your preferred laser level online and check the warranty information before purchase. You should also be wary of products that come with less than a 1-year warranty, rather, you should go for ones with 2 or more warranty years as they offer better quality. If possible, check for a rotary laser level with a money back guarantee so you can return it within 30 days if there is a fault.

In addition to the precautionary steps you should take when searching for cheap rotary laser levels, you should also pay attention to some other key factors for selecting the best rotary laser level. For instance, all rotary laser levels operate 360 degrees but not all rotary laser levels project both horizontal and vertical beams. For most projects, a horizontal beam should be enough, but certain projects can be made quicker by projecting both vertical and horizontal beams at the same time. A cross-line rotary laser level may cost more than a single-line rotary laser level but a cross-line level that projects vertically and horizontally will handle multiple projects, thus saving you energy, time, and costs of operations.
